.... hi there 3 legs, good to see a new face.There is plenty of threads

around in the archives, I picked this up last season and although the

season was well advanced, a system was developed, which again has

now been extended to this season.It was developed from the Michael

Wray website where his spreadsheets can be downloaded at :-

www.michaelwray.co.nz . In these sheets there are match predictions

for all the various leagues and all the various dates.I based this system

on those matches where Michael's sheets predict a 3-0 win, on the basis

that if the confidence is there to predict a 3-0 win, then that team

should stand a great chance to win the match regardless of taking the

3-0 scoreline.Therefore all selections 42 in total currently, have been

backed at £10 stakes, and show a profit as we speak.On hindsight, if

I were to start this season again, I would wait until the season is around

a month old to eliminate some early season losers due to uncertain

form, the figures would make better reading and show a distinct

improved yield if this had been followed.Hope this goes some way to

explanation,if not,please ask, when I shall endeavour to enlighten you

further.

.... hi Joey and welcome to the thread, hope that you are getting something out of it. The numbers against each team are the odds obtainable at that point in time, and displayed for the purposes of keeping a track of the system bets.Most of the time much better odds can be obtained from Betfair so if I was to do this,then the table above would look much better.These bets are currently backed as singles,but really up to those punters who want to choose their own methods.The table displays only singles, and was only born last season out of the ashes of previous attempts to make the Michael Wray spreadsheets profitable.If you look back in the archives at Page 9 - Michael Wray Spreadsheets, there has been much discussion on this which went towards the system evolving as a serious attempted profit making proposition.Several lessons have been learned,and I feel that there is certainly merits in continuing with such a system.Cheers.
ps Last season after starting late, the system finished £46.69 ahead.
